Last updated: 3 months agoH0539 — Admin procedure act, temp rules
Idaho House Bill 539, sponsored by Representative Ehlers, has been signed into law and makes changes to the state's Administrative Procedure Act regarding temporary rules. The bill passed overwhelmingly in both chambers (67-2 in the House and 33-1 in the Senate) and was signed by the governor on March 17, 2026.

H0511 — Private forest land, surcharge
House Bill 511, sponsored by Rep. Boyle, creates or modifies a surcharge related to private forest land in Idaho and has been signed into law by the governor. The bill passed both chambers of the legislature with the House approving it 46-22 and the Senate passing it 26-9.
